CJPF Award 2025 Second Prize in the video category for the PR video of Uji City

Uji City, Kyoto Prefecture, won the runner-up prize in the video category of the "CJPF Award 2025," a contest for videos promoting the attractions of Japan to overseas audiences. The award-winning work "Uji has a Story" is a 6-minute 30 second movie produced by Kyoto Animation based on the fact that Uji City is the setting of the last ten chapters of Murasaki Shikibu's masterpiece "The Tale of Genji". The judges highly praised the film, saying, "This is a wonderful work by Kyoto Animation, the world's top studio located in Uji City, depicting the charm, history, and excitement of Uji through animation that will be favorably recognized as Japan by people all over the world. The film was highly acclaimed. Mayor Junko Matsumura commented, "Through this work, we hope to convey the charms of Uji to people of all ages. Check out the award-winning video on YouTube.
